1) The two types of coverage that Atlantis offers.

You’re going to find that there are two sorts of insurance coverage on offer here, and you can either go with one or the other.  It’s important you know what they both entail beforehand, so that you can make a more informed decision as to which will make you feel the most comfortable when you’re in need of medical treatment.

-HMO or Health Maintenance Organization.

This is where you actually have one primary care physician that administers care to you, or that signs off on the care that you will receive.  This can be advantageous because then it means one doctor is pouring over your charts, and you can ensure they are able to make sure nothing you’re taking or doing interacts negatively with something else. However if you have a disagreement with your doctor and they will not sign off on a procedure, insurance will not cover the operation.

-POS or Point of Service plans.

These are a lot like the HMO in that you are given a PCP, but you are given more choice into who is going to be that PCP.  From there, you also have the option of going to different specialists if your primary care physician determines that you need their input.  Then once you’re handed off, everything the specialist suggests will be approved by  your insurance in the same way that it would be from your PCP.

You’ll find that the HMO option is usually the most affordable, with these types of plans being the cheapest because the insurance company has less room for error with only one person pouring over the forms.  But while a POS can be more expensive, they are a good idea when you want to be in better control of your actual care.
